Aligning filesystems to an SSD’s erase block size
Read OriginalThis article explains the importance of aligning filesystems to an SSD's erase block size (128k) and 4k sector boundaries for performance. It details how to use specific fdisk parameters (-H 224 -S 56) on Linux to achieve proper alignment, discusses implications for RAID and future hard drives, and compares Linux's default partitioning with Windows Vista's approach.
